Retail The Retail industry sector is characterized by a unique and broad variety. Following common description of retail activites - buying goods, moving goods, selling goods - content and specifics relating tovarious sub-sectors are very diverse.

Despite economic and financial crises, today the retail sector is in a better position than ever before. What might be the reasons for this? We believe that the constant incentive of  strong competition and the continuous "need to optimise" will always push retail to achieve record performances. Retail usually deals with very high product volumes. On the one handsmall profit margins can reap large returns, but unfortunately it can also turn small mistakes into big problems. The complexity of retail is often underestimated: Even the smallest mistake can expand into a full-blown disaster. Thats why profound experiences in retail industry and involved processes play a decisive role. . Knowing your client and his wishes is what in the end makes up your added value.

Consumer Goods More than ever, manufacturers of consumer products need to focus on cost reduction, as well as on efficiency and economic viability.

This sector needs to pay special attention to  supply chain management and  optimization potential ;  disregardingwhether a company belongs to Fast Moving Consumer Goods (FMCG) or Slow Moving Consumer Goods (SMCG) segment. For sure the Agenda shall comprise all opportunities for increasing sales , including internet as distribution channel: How can a multi-channel business, or even better a cross-channel business  work successfully? In this area significant transformation are forthcoming for many companies.

To turn strategic goals quickly into initiatives that  significantly reduce costs and increase sales, a broad knowledge of the industry sector and best practices  are required, together with a sure hand when it comes to organisation and high-quality IT systems.

Fashion No sector has undergone such rapid changes in the last few years as the fashion industry. Transformation was and is the number one priority.

Globalisation of the supply chain from the raw materials to the finished items of clothing requires in-depth rethinking; the focus on cost reduction, efficiency and economic viability has never been so important. In parallel, many companies are looking for new sales opportunities, especially in e-commerce and on the Internet: how can a cross-channel business function successfully? This is an area where many companies can expect significant transformation in the future.

And this is not about running blindly after every new fashion trend. The implementation of strategic goals must be clearly demonstrated in lower costs and higher sales. We believe that in order to achieve this implementation quickly, your processes, organisational structure and IT systems must work in perfect coordination.

Selected references - Excerpt (we would be happy to send you a case study on request)

Dansk Supermarked AS

Dansk Supermarked, a leading retailing company in Northern Europe, has started the big »APOLLO« transformation project. The aim is to display all key processes on the SAP RETAIL platform in a uniform manner. Responsible project partner: KPS.
Download LZ-article

ESPRIT

ESPRIT is currently working flat out on its biggest ever transformation initiative “EPS” and is just about to reach some important milestones. This is the only project in which the SAP industry sector solutions AFS and RETAIL are used in a fully integrated manner.
Project partner: KPS.

s.Oliver

s.Oliver has begun the transformation initiative “S4”, which will lead to an extensive modernisation of all company processes based on SAP RETAIL. Responsible project partner: KPS.

Escada

ESCADA is carrying out the turn-around project “PEGASUS” under the leadership of its new management and owner. This involves reengineering of all processes and introducing SAP. Responsible project partner: KPS.

Switcher

Switcher carried out the standardisation and harmonisation of company processes based on the KPS best practices fashion scenarios. Responsible project partner: KPS.

Hugo Boss

HUGO BOSS has recently successfully completed some important milestones (as part of a project that goes by the name of “COLUMBUS”) of one of the biggest transformation initiatives in company history and is now developing them further. Responsible project partner: KPS.

Gebr. Heinemann

Gebr. Heinemann, a worldwide leading  retail firm active in travel centres (airports) and in the duty free sector, is currently carrying out the transformation initiative “GENERATION 5” based on SAP RETAIL.
